Somalia's ambassador to the United Nations recently accused Ethiopian troops of making illegal incursions across their shared border. Relations between the two countries have continued to decline ever since Ethiopia signed a non-binding agreement with the breakaway Republic of Somaliland earlier this year.
Why Africans continue to pay a high price for denied visas into Europe.
And how floating solar panels can help Africa become more energy sufficient.
